Its called Diva vodka and is gem filtered, just a few details: New luxury vodka is called Diva vodka. It first gets ice-filtered, then filtered through Nordic birch charcoal and then passed trhough a sand of crushed diamonds and gems (We can almost see someone crush and crumble the gems vigorously). What is especially fascinating, is the price. In every bottle you’ll find semi-precious or precious stones, including diamonds, which will make the product price range from $ 70.00 up to $ 1,060,000.00 . Launched during Christmas in Scotland last year, every bottle from Diva Vodka's Bespoke range contains a tube-like wand filled with lead-free jewels like amethyst, aquamarine, topaz and even gold nuggets. The wand is submerged in smooth, crystal clear vodka made with spring water triple distilled through diamond and ruby sand. The stones tumble out when you remove the stopper at the top of the wand, but otherwise remain safely in the wand when you pour the vodka out of the bottle. prices range from £2,000 to a mind-blowing £540,000!!!! :eek: :eek: Cheers to all!
